Perhaps I’m nuts, but instead of one centerpiece item; perhaps getting a substantial start on your vintage collection might provide more satisfaction than acquiring just one or two cards. For $700 or so, you could purchase quite afew common ballplayers, in lower grade. There should be a reasonable selection of early tobacco, gum, and candy cards available for under $30 or so. And with the National Show taking place in Cleveland, there may be a greater-than-usual abundance of Detroit Tiger cards, since Detroit is reasonably located within a 2-hours drive from Cleveland. As your vintage collection evolves, you may find that a particular vintage card will establish itself as the centerpiece you seek. For me, it was a 1914/1915 Cracker Jack Ty Cobb card that I set my sights on. The centerpiece changed as each prior target piece was acquired. The hunt certainly adds to the challenge and enjoyment of the hobby. Good Luck to you in Cleveland. |
